First off, let’s talk about what PFA is. PFA is a by – product of coal – fired power stations. When coal is burned in these power plants, the fine ash particles are collected from the flue gases. It’s a fine, powdery material that has some unique properties, and these properties make it a potentially great candidate for road construction.

One of the main benefits of using PFA in road construction is its pozzolanic properties. Pozzolans are materials that, when mixed with calcium hydroxide in the presence of water, form cementitious compounds. In the context of road construction, this means that PFA can react with the lime in the soil or other cementitious materials used in road building. This reaction helps to strengthen the road structure. For example, when PFA is added to soil – cement mixtures, it can increase the compressive strength of the mixture over time. This is crucial for roads because they need to withstand the weight of traffic, and a stronger road structure means less maintenance and a longer lifespan.

Another advantage is its environmental friendliness. Using PFA in road construction is a great way to recycle a waste product. Instead of letting the PFA sit in landfills, we can put it to good use. This not only reduces the amount of waste going to landfills but also conserves natural resources. For instance, by using PFA, we can reduce the need for virgin materials like cement and aggregates. Cement production is a major contributor to greenhouse gas emissions, so by substituting some of the cement with PFA, we can help cut down on these emissions.

Let’s look at some real – world examples. In many countries, PFA has been used in various road construction projects. In the UK, for example, PFA has been used in the construction of motorways and other major roads. The roads built with PFA – based materials have shown good performance in terms of durability and strength. In some cases, the use of PFA has also helped to reduce the cost of road construction. Since PFA is a waste product, it’s often available at a lower cost compared to traditional construction materials.

Now, there are also some challenges to using PFA in road construction. One of the main issues is the variability of PFA quality. The composition of PFA can vary depending on the type of coal burned in the power station and the collection process. This variability can affect the performance of the PFA in road construction. For example, if the PFA has a high carbon content, it can interfere with the setting and hardening of the cementitious mixtures. So, it’s important to test the PFA before using it in road projects to ensure its quality.

Another challenge is the public perception. Some people are skeptical about using a waste product in road construction. They might be worried about the safety and long – term effects. However, numerous studies have shown that when used properly, PFA is safe and can provide good performance. For example, the leaching of heavy metals from PFA – based road materials is usually within acceptable limits, and the environmental impact is minimal.
